Understanding the Core Mechanics of the Aviator Game

At its heart, the aviator game is based on a provably fair random number generator (RNG). This ensures that each round is independent and unbiased, offering transparency to players. You begin by placing a bet before each round. As the round commences, a plane takes off and steadily climbs higher. The multiplier value increases with altitude, directly correlating with your potential winnings. The key element is timing – you must cash out your bet before the plane flies away. If you cash out in time, you receive your initial bet multiplied by the current multiplier. However, if the plane disappears before you cash out, you lose your stake.

The simplicity of these mechanics is deceptive. While the game is easy to learn, mastering it requires understanding the probabilities, bankroll management, and psychological factors influencing decision-making. Many players find themselves caught between the desire for a large payout and the fear of losing their initial bet. It’s crucial to approach the aviator game with a well-defined strategy, rather than relying solely on luck. A common technique is setting an automatic cash-out multiplier, removing the emotional element from the equation.

Strategies for Maximizing Your Winnings

Numerous strategies are employed by players aiming to increase their chances of winning at the aviator game. One popular approach is the Martingale strategy, which invol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the expectation of recouping previous losses and making a small profit when you eventually win. However, the Martingale strategy requires a substantial bankroll and carries significant risk, as losing streaks can quickly deplete your funds. Another strategy is setting ‘stop-loss’ and ‘take-profit’ limits. A stop-loss limit is the maximum amount you’re willing to lose in a single session, while a take-profit limit is the amount you want to win.

A more conservative approach favors consistent, smaller payouts. By setting an automatic cash-out multiplier between 1.2x and 1.5x, players aim to win more frequently, albeit with smaller returns. This strategy minimizes risk and can help build a steady bankroll over time. The reverse strategy involves going for higher multipliers, accepting a lower win-rate. This is a high-risk, high-reward approach that requires patience and a solid understanding of the game’s volatility.

It’s essential to remember that no strategy can guarantee profits. The aviator game is, by nature, a game of chance. However, by utilizing a combination of strategic thinking, bankroll management, and an understanding of probabilities, players can significantly improve their odds and potentially increase their winnings. The Psychology of the Aviator Game

The aviator game’s captivating nature isn’t solely due to its mechanics. Psychological factors play a significant role in its enduring appeal. The game leverages the principles of variable ratio reinforcement, a concept widely used in gambling. This means that rewards are dispensed after an unpredictable number of responses (in this case, rounds), making the experience highly addictive. The near-miss effect – where the plane almost reaches a desired multiplier before flying away – contributes to the illusion of control and encourages players to keep trying.

The visual and auditory elements of the game also enhance its immersive quality. The escalating multiplier, the rising plane, and the dramatic sound effects create a sense of anticipation and excitement. Furthermore, the social aspect of the game, with live chat features and leaderboards, fosters a sense of community and competition. This encourages players to continue playing, driven by the desire to outperform their peers.

Understanding these psychological drivers is crucial for responsible gaming. It’s essential to recognize that the game is designed to be engaging and potentially addictive. Setting limits, taking breaks, and avoiding chasing losses are fundamental principles of responsible gambling. Here are some warning signs of potential problem gambling:

  1. Spending more time and money on the game than you can afford.
  2. Chasing losses, attempting to recoup money lost by increasing the size of your bets.
  3. Experiencing feelings of guilt or shame related to your gambling.
  4. Neglecting personal responsibilities due to your gambling.

Understanding Odds and Volatility

The aviator game, while appearing straightforward, has an underlying volatility that impacts your potential winnings. Volatility refers to the degree of variation in outcomes. A highly volatile game will feature infrequent but substantial wins, while a low-volatility game will offer more frequent but smaller wins. The aviator game generally falls into the medium-to-high volatility category. This means you can experience long periods of losing streaks punctuated by occasional large payouts.

The Return to Player (RTP) is another key metric to consider. RTP represents the percentage of all wagered money that is returned to players over time. While the exact RTP can vary between platforms, it usually falls around 97%. This means that, on average, players can expect to receive back 97% of their wagers over the long term. However, it’s essential to remember that RTP is a theoretical average and does not guarantee any individual outcome.

Responsible Gaming and Staying Safe

The thrill of the aviator game can be exhilarating, but it’s crucial to remember that it is first and foremost a form of entertainment. Responsible gaming is paramount. Always set a budget before you start playing and stick to it rigorously. Never chase losses – attempting to recoup money lost will often lead to further financial hardship. Take frequent breaks to avoid getting caught up in the moment and making impulsive decisions.

Choose reputable platforms with strong security measures and a proven track record of fair play. Look for platforms that offer tools for self-exclusion and deposit limits, allowing you to control your gaming habits. Be wary of anyone offering guaranteed winning strategies or claiming to have insider knowledge – these are often scams designed to exploit vulnerable players. Remember gambling should always remain a fun leisure activity, it shouldn’t be a source of financial stress or emotional distress. This can be done by setting limits, regular breaks and never chasing losses.

If you or someone you know is struggling with problem gambling, seek help from organizations such as the National Council on Problem Gambling. They offer support, resources, and guidance for those affected by gambling addiction.
